Abstract

Mathematical model of mechanical behavior of viscoelastic bodies in complex stress state with regard to phase (crystallization) transitions, which describes technological stress field formation regularities in manufacturing polymer articles, is considered. Constitutive relationships describing stress and strain tensors correlation in a wide temperature range, including crystallization temperatures, are suggested. The thermal mechanics boundary-value problem that includes the obtained relationships is formulated. Algorithms of numerical realization of the temperature-conversion problem and the crystallizing system stress-strain state definition problem for an axisymmetric case are examined. Numerical realization features of the mechanical problem solution are discussed. The problem of technological stresses formation during steel and polyethylene tubes permanent connection manufacturing has been solved as the mathematical model application.
